1995 Chevrolet G20 Chevy Van 5.7L 9 Port Vacuum Mode Switch
Posted to GM HVAC on 4/30/2009 3 Replies

Some of the ports on the 9 port vacuum control switch are eaten away causing air flow to stay on the floor no matter where the mode lever is set. The ports look almost like they have been sand blasted off. We have replaced this part many times on this vehicle,...
